Abstract

Official abstract text for this publication.

A method and an apparatus for text effect processing, an electronic device, and a computer readable storage medium. The method comprises: sending to a server a request to acquire a text effect resource, the text effect resource being used to implement a display effect of text associated with multimedia; receiving a text effect resource sent by the server; and on the basis of the text effect resource, performing color-separated effect processing on text, causing text of different color components to be synchronously and dynamically displayed on a terminal screen, following playback progress of the multimedia.

First claim

Opening claim text (preview).

The invention claimed is: 1. A method for text effect processing, comprising: transmitting a request for obtaining a text effect resource to a server, wherein the text effect resource is configured to implement a display effect of texts associated with a multimedia; receiving the text effect resource from the server; and synchronously and dynamically displaying the texts with different color components on a screen of a terminal during playing the multimedia according to a playback progress of the multimedia by performing color separation effect processing on the texts based on the text effect resource. 2. The method according to claim 1 , wherein the performing color separation effect processing on the texts based on the text effect resource to synchronously and dynamically display the texts having different color components on a screen of a terminal with a playback progress of the multimedia comprises: obtaining a time stamp corresponding to the playback progress of the multimedia and texts corresponding to the time stamp; and performing color separation effect processing on the texts corresponding to the time stamp based on the text effect resource to synchronously and dynamically display the texts having different color components on the screen of the terminal with the playback progress of the multimedia. 3. The method according to claim 2 , wherein the performing color separation effect processing on the texts based on the text effect resource to synchronously and dynamically display the texts having different color components on a screen of a terminal with a playback progress of the multimedia comprises: typesetting the texts corresponding to the time stamp based on a typesetting parameter in the text effect resource, and generating a bitmap; transmitting the bitmap to an image processor of the terminal to obtain a texture corresponding to the texts; determining an offset direction and an offset distance of each of color components in the texture based on the time stamp; and rendering the texture by the image processor, and offsetting, for each of the color components, texts corresponding to the color component by the offset distance of the color component along the offset direction of the color component. 4. The method according to claim 1 , further comprising: running a local script program based on a script file in the text effect resource; and performing color separation effect processing on the texts based on the script program. 5.
